Enrolment Information
Gosford High School is an academically selective coeducational high school for students in Years 7 to 12.
Placements for Year 7 are offered through the NSW Department of Education’s High Performance Students Unit.
Applications for Years 8 to 11 in 2027 will open in June 2026.
